**Step 7 — Verify incremental rebuilds before key rotation.** Trigger a single-page edit on the Larchpress staging site and confirm only that page rebuilds in the Quince dashboard; a full rebuild means the dependency graph is stale and the ceremony must pause. Once verified, the signing station can be unlocked using the recovery passphrase recorded below.

unlock words, hahip-baduf: holwyn-istath-julvan

## Ledger accrual hooks for plugin authors

Adds stable extension points to the Kestrelworth loyalty-points ledger. Plugins may now register accrual modifiers and redemption guards without touching core tables. Ordering is deterministic: modifiers run by priority, ties broken by registration time. Breaking change: `onAccrue` now receives an immutable snapshot; mutate via the returned delta object only. Rate limits apply per plugin, not per merchant. All thresholds below are enforced server-side. The current tuning constants are as follows.

constants for tafog-kahag:
RATE_LIMITS = {
    "sorir": 697,
    "oliox": 683,
    "holax": 176,
    "casox": 60,
    "pelius": 382,
}

**Ticket: Catalog cache invalidation drifting between regions**

Hey folks — new joiners, this one's a good intro to the Pricklefruit catalog stack. The cache invalidation TTLs in the east region no longer match what's in the deploy repo, so stale product entries linger after price updates. Someone hand-edited the live config last quarter and it stuck. The current live values we pulled from the running service are below.

config for kafof-bawef:
holath:
  log_level: debug
  metrics_host: metrics.holath.qorvelsys.internal
  pin: 2191
  pool_size: 32